If it was a mistranslation I agree with it. Usyk had to negate size and strength against both and obviously found Fury the harder to outbox (at least first time), but Joshua brings a lot more of Ngannou's physical threat to Fury with superior skills.

It's likely won or lost in their heads at this point though. Joshua's loss was more devastating on paper, but he did go out on his shield and might salvage belief from that. Fury might bash him up but you'd think he's unlikely to poleaxe him. Whereas the thought of Joshua landing fortuitously is compelling.

It's still a fight I'd be more hyped for than I was for either against Usyk.

AJ has been prepared to take the Fury fight for some time now. Another example of a quality boxer Fury has seemingly dodged at various stages of his career....Price for the British title, Klitschko rematch and AJ....meanwhile Fury happy to box Chisora 3 times ! :doh:

The first Chisora fight was ok considering the stage of Fury's career and it was for the British title, the second fight was not needed at all and turned out to be as shit as we thought it would, the third fight was just spitting in the face of the fans and insulting them with a total waste of time.

That said, I think AJ would benefit from a couple of quick succession wins to help his mindset following the disastrous loss to Dubois.
